I have a number of OWC thunderbay 4s with TB2 connection. First to my MBP2015 and now to a MP2013. I'm guessing that sooner or later I'll need to switch to a new computer, which won't have TB2 and only has TB3. What to do then?
I hear that the Apple TB2-TB3 connectors are suspect. What's the best way to move on please?
The Apple brand adapters work fine. Its non Apple that are a problem they work for monitors only.
So you may need one or two of them.
I have not experience any issues with Apple's TB2 to TB3 adapter which is connected to a Mac mini USB-C. It's a reliable but also expensive adapter. I was concerned about decreasing speed, but it turnout as fast as before. Another big plus is there is no need to replace all TB2 devices for now.
Cheers, that's good to know.
I use a few of the tb2 to tb3 adapters for my thunder bays and 4m2’s and they work fine. But as was pointed out before, you’re best bet is to pay the extra price and buy genuine Apple adapters.
Correct.
In fact, most non Apple adapters will have problems if you try to get high throughput through them (like RAID)
